(PHP 4 >= 4.3.2, PHP 5, PHP 7)
imageistruecolor — Bir resmin gerçek renkli olup olmadığını bulur
$resim
)imageistruecolor() işlevi belirtilen resmin bir gerçek renkli resim olup olmadığına bakar.
resim
imagecreatetruecolor() gibi bir resim oluşturma işlevinden dönen bir resim verisi.
resim
gerçek renkli ise TRUE
aksi takdirde FALSE
döner.
Örnek 1 - imageistruecolor() ile resmin gerçek renkli olup olmadığının saptanması
<?php
// $im bir resim tanıtıcısı olsun
// Bakalım resim gerçek renkli miymiş?
if(!imageistruecolor($im))
{
// Değilse gerçek renkli yeni bir taslak oluşturalım
$tc = imagecreatetruecolor(imagesx($im), imagesy($im));
imagecopy($tc, $im, 0, 0, 0, 0, imagesx($im), imagesy($im));
imagedestroy($im);
$im = $tc;
$tc = NULL;
}
// Resim taslağıyla çalışmaya devam
?>
Bilginize: Bu işlev GD'nin 2.0.1 veya sonraki sürümlerini gerektirir (2.0.28 veya sonraki sürümler önerilir).